TIG welding (Tungsten Inert Gas welding), also known as GTAW (Gas Tungsten Arc Welding), is a highly precise welding process widely used in metal fabrication. It employs a non-consumable tungsten electrode to create the weld, while an inert shielding gas—typically argon—protects the weld area from contamination.
This method is ideal for achieving high-quality, clean, and strong welds on a variety of metals, including stainless steel, aluminium, and other non-ferrous alloys. TIG welding is especially valued for applications requiring accuracy, aesthetic finish, and durability, such as in custom metalworks, piping, and structural components.
